Ever since the announcement of KENTA’s knee injury, ROH officials have been hard at work trying to find a suitable replacement for the GHC Jr. Heavyweight champion. After some back and forth discussions, representatives from Pro Wrestling NOAH and Kensuke Office came up with an exemplary replacement in the form of the former GHC Jr. Heavyweight Champion Katsuhiko Nakajima!!!
Nakajima hasn’t participated in an ROH event since “Take No Prisoners 2009” when he paired with Austin Aries in a losing effort against Tyler Black & KENTA, but he also was part of some of the hardest hitting affairs in the last year in his matches with Bryan Danielson from “Glory by Honor VII” and Roderick Strong at “Supercard of Honor IV”.
